MCA treasurer Jagdish Achrekar wants mentor for struggling Mumbai team

Earlier, Achrekar had requested the MCA president to call an urgent Apex Council meeting to discuss Mumbai’s poor showing in the Syed Mushtaq Ali T20 and Vijay Hazare Trophy

Mumbai Cricket Association (MCA) treasurer Jagdish Achrekar has called for the urgent appointment of a mentor for the struggling Mumbai senior team before the Ranji Trophy season begins next month.

In an email to MCA president Dr Vijay Patil, Achrekar suggested the names of former India skipper Dilip Vengsarkar, India’s 1983 World Cup-winning team swing bowler and Mumbai coach Balvinder Singh Sandhu, ex-Mumbai chief selector Milind Rege and former Test pacer Raju Kulkarni.
